Foto de stock - Berlin, Germany: c. 1932 Photographer and photojopurnalist Willie Ruge and his partner prepare to take the first underwater photographs outside of a diving bell. Their shoes weigh 36 pounds and the combined gear for this venture below the surface of the Elbe River weighed in at 320 pounds. Here they are getting the final instructions as they descend into the Elbe River.
